Back in September we conducted an auction at the former Northfield Middle School. Northfield has a new Middle School and we sold the surplus property at the old Middle School. Even though we had an excellent auction, we had a number of metal student desks, metal teacher’s desks, and miscellaneous items that didn’t sell. I always hate to see usable items go to waste. Enter Patti Riebold of Connecting Connections in Red Wing. Patti has put her seemingly boundless energy to use in developing a way to rescue unneeded items in the Midwest, transport them to Honduras in Central America, and give the items a new life. On February 26, Patti brought a team of 10 very hard workers from Sentenced to Serve who loaded a 50 foot semi full of surplus school equipment to be sent to Honduras.
